Bridge Snapshot: SR 36

The SR 36 bridge in Lamar, Georgia carries SR 36 over HIGH FALLS CREEK. It was built in 1952, making it 74 years old today. The structure is built primarily of concrete and spans 3 sections, stretching 9.8 meters (32 feet) end to end. Daily traffic averages 8,010 vehicles, placing it in the moderately-trafficked tier of Georgia bridges. It is owned and maintained by State Highway Agency.

The latest FHWA inspection records show culvert at 7/9. The weakest component sits in good condition. All reported major components score above the Poor range. Its NBI inventory load rating is 24.4 metric tons.

How to read this record

This page shows what the last federal inspection recorded, not whether SR 36 is safe to cross today. Here is how to use it.

  • NBI condition ratings reflect the latest record in this annual dataset, not a live status. Current routine inspection intervals are risk-based.

Condition codes come straight from the FHWA National Bridge Inventory and are not a real-time safety judgment. Only the owning agency, a state DOT, county, or other owner, can post, restrict, or close a bridge.
